Now, they are providing free online subscriptions to teachers and students who are at what the federal government considers “Title 1” High Schools:

The Times is excited to partner with Verizon to provide free access to nytimes.com, in line with our shared commitment to fostering education.

Faculty and students at Title 1 high schools can now receive free New York Times digital subscriptions while connected to their school network.
